Exploring the Artistic Mastery of Nikolai Ge's Portrait of Joseph Daumang

Historical Context of the Portrait: A Glimpse into 19th Century Russia

The Life and Times of Nikolai Ge: Influences and Inspirations

Nikolai Ge, born in 1831, was a prominent Russian painter known for his deep emotional expressions and realistic portrayals. He studied at the prestigious Imperial Academy of Arts in St. Petersburg. Influenced by the Romantic movement, Ge's work often reflected the social and political climate of 19th century Russia. His exposure to Western art during his travels in Europe enriched his style, blending realism with a touch of romanticism. Ge's commitment to capturing the human spirit is evident in his portraits, including the remarkable "Portrait of Joseph Daumang."
